> Simple:
>
> 1. # rm -rf /usr/src/linux
> 2. tar xvzf /path-to-the-kernal/linux-2.2.2.tar.gz
> 3. mv /usr/src/linux /usr/src/linux-2.2.2
> 3. ln -s /usr/src/linux-2.2.2 /usr/src/linux
> 4. cd linux
> 5. make xconfig (see /usr/src/linux/README)
> 6. make mrproper dep clean bzImage modules modules_install
> 7. mv /usr/src/linux/arch/i386/boot/bzImage /boot/vmlinuz
> 8. /sbin/lilo
> 9 reboot
>
> Modify as needed.

Dee,
Can I just add one thing to your statement. That being:
4.5. less Changes (read the Changes files)
This will save some the problems getting their printers, masq, etc. running.
